AEML

Adani Electricity Mumbai Limited

Verified 2026-09-04

Mumbai suburbs (roughly Bandra to Dahisar and Sion/Kurla to Mankhurd) plus Mira-Bhayandar; the largest of the three Mumbai distribution licensees.

Tata Power Mumbai

The Tata Power Company Limited (Mumbai Distribution)

Verified 2026-09-04

Parallel distribution licence over about 485 sq km of Mumbai from Colaba to Mira-Bhayandar, overlapping the BEST and AEML areas; roughly 8 lakh consumers.

MSEDCL (Mahavitaran)

Maharashtra State Electricity Distribution Company Limited

Verified 2026-09-04

All of Maharashtra outside Mumbai city and suburbs (which are served by BEST, AEML and Tata Power); Bhiwandi and Shil-Mumbra-Kalwa (Thane) are operated by franchisee Torrent Power on MSEDCL's behalf.

Why does the next street have power and you don't?

In most Indian cities your supply comes off a feeder shared with a few neighbouring areas. When a transformer overheats in summer, the discom often switches areas off in turn to let it cool — so your neighbour's lights come back while yours go out. Complaining moves the cut; it doesn't end it. Knowing this changes what you should do.
